#ae9d68 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ae9d68 is composed of 68.2% red, 61.6% green and 40.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 9.8% magenta, 40.2% yellow and 31.8% black. It has a hue angle of 45.4 degrees, a saturation of 30.2% and a lightness of 54.5%. #ae9d68 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ffd0 with #5d3b00. Closest websafe color is: #999966.

● #ae9d68 color description : Mostly desaturated dark yellow.
#ae9d68 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ae9d68 has RGB values of R:174, G:157, B:104 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.1, Y:0.4, K:0.32. Its decimal value is 11443560.
